Abstract | Four brands of beer glass bottles (green (G1, G2) and brown (B1, B2)) were examined for thickness using a micrometer. X-ray diffraction study (X-ray Diffractometer (XRD)) confirmed the amorphous nature of the samples. The analysis elements in the samples were determined using X-ray fluorescence spectrometry (XRF). And the absorbance of the sample bottles was examined using a Shimadzu UV-3600 Spectrophotometer. The reflection, transmission and absorption of the samples were investigated using a Shimadzu UV-3600 Spectrophotometer. Inspection revealed that sample B1 glass bottles had the highest reflectance and lowest transmittance. In addition, the absorption curves of the green samples (G1 and G2) showed absorption peaks at 448 and 657 nm and a wavelength band of 1098 nm for the brown sample (B1 and B2). Examination of the B1 brown glass bottle has higher reflectance and lower transmittance. It can be concluded that the B1 brown glass bottle has more protection from solar radiation than the green G1, G2 and B2 brown glass bottles, which affects the flavor inside the bottle.
